As nouns, boundary is a hypernym of perimeter; that is, boundary is a word with a broader meaning than perimeter:
  • perimeter: the boundary line or the area immediately inside the boundary
  • boundary: a line determining the limits of an area
Other hypernyms of perimeter include bound, edge.
